Quick Tip – Finding (*) Stars in Excel
Posted by admin on Jan 8, 2010 in Uncategorized |
This is a really quick post.
Today I was looking to see if I could find a star “*” in excel and everytime I pressed search excel treated it as a wildcard and highlighted every cell in turn one by one.
To find the star I had to use the excel escape character of tilda “~”
so in the end in the search box I typed ~* and it found the star just fine.
